Transaction 9528b85f23055af1740923d92fa5e24a2a8d0a40106f8ae257f62fc6b17a0485
1 Input
1 Output
-
9528b85f23055af1740923d92fa5e24a2a8d0a40106f8ae257f62fc6b17a0485:0
- value
- 41442
- script pubkey
- OP_0 OP_PUSHBYTES_32 d87cbaf703d241af57f19b9f2d74a7112e8d96e5ce88b1cb8a60fe09260ee4ea
- address
- bc1qmp7t4acr6fq674l3nw0j6a98zyhgm9h9e6ytrju2vrlqjfswun4q63rtf6